DeepSonar: Dual-engine identification of ships from hydrophones
About
Passive sonar information captured from hydrophones installed in ships or submarines can be analysed in real-time for automatic detection and identification of ships. The project will be developed in two stages:
-
Generic ship classes and non-ship special events (like seismic activity, marine mammals or other human activity) will be detected.
-
Specific vessels will be registered, detected and identified.
Taking advantage of our expertise in related technologies, a combined approach of AI deep learning and supervised stochastic models is envisioned as an hybrid solution. Specific advanced signal processing, filtering and enhancing techniques will be applied as a front-end before the automatic pattern recognition module.
